The Quakes are in Lake Elsinore this week, and will need to win the first three games of the series to claim the first-half South Division title. The first half ends Thursday, with Rancho Cucamonga trailing the Lake Elsinore Storm (Padres) by three games. The winner of each half of each division makes the playoffs in the California League. In 13 appearances between Rancho Cucamonga and Great Lakes this season, he has a 2.83 ERA in 41⅓ innings, with 42 strikeouts (25-percent K rate) and 23 walks. Peto was an undrafted free agent signed by the Dodgers out of Stetson in 2020.

Peto struck out seven in his 4⅓ scoreless innings, allowing only a single and two walks. The right-hander escaped that jam with no further damage, then pitched into the ninth. Robbie Peto entered the High-A Great Lakes game with the bases loaded and one out in the fifth, Great Lakes trailing 2-1.
